This clause establishes the mechanism and timeline for policy modification. It places the burden of awareness on the user through periodic review of the posted policy, rather than requiring affirmative consent to modifications before they take effect.
Users operating under this provision are subject to Privacy Policy terms as modified by Egnyte through page posting. The mechanism requires users to initiate review of the policy to identify changes, as continued service use after posting constitutes acceptance of the modified terms.

"We may update our Privacy Policy from time to time. We will notify you of any changes by posting the new Privacy Policy on this page and updating the effective date. You are advised to review this Privacy Policy periodically for any changes. Changes to this Privacy Policy are effective when they are posted on this page.— Excerpt from Egnyte's Egnyte Privacy Policy
